Dragon fruit Market Size, Share Valuation and Future Forecast, 2033

The global dragon fruit consumption is expected to be valued at approximately $507.3 million in 2023, with a forecasted growth rate of 6.7% per year, ultimately reaching $973.6 million by the close of 2033, according to the most recent market analysis from Persistence Market Research. Market challenges in the dragon fruit market:

Price Volatility: Dragon fruit prices can fluctuate due to various factors, including seasonal variations, supply and demand imbalances, and quality issues. This can affect the profitability of growers and traders.

Perishability: Dragon fruit is a highly perishable fruit. Proper handling, transportation, and storage are essential to maintain its quality and extend its shelf life. Inadequate post-harvest handling can result in significant losses.

Competition: As the market for dragon fruit grows, competition among producers can increase. This can lead to pricing pressures and the need for differentiation to maintain market share.

Weather Conditions: Dragon fruit cultivation is sensitive to weather conditions. Extreme weather events, such as typhoons or droughts, can impact production and quality. Climate change and unpredictable weather patterns pose a significant challenge.

Regulations and Standards: Compliance with international food safety and quality standards is crucial for accessing export markets. Meeting these standards can be a challenge for some producers and may require investments in infrastructure and processes.

Pest and Disease Management: Dragon fruit plants can be susceptible to pests and diseases. Effective pest and disease management strategies are necessary to maintain healthy crops and prevent yield losses.

Labour Shortages: Labour shortages, especially in agricultural regions, can affect the harvest and post-harvest processes. Finding and retaining skilled labour can be challenging for dragon fruit farms.
